tpl是什么数据库
-
TPL(Template Database)是一个数据库模板的缩写。数据库模板是指预定义的数据库结构和数据,用于快速创建数据库的基础框架。TPL数据库模板通常包括表、字段、索引等数据库对象的定义,以及初始数据的插入。
TPL数据库模板的使用可以大大提高数据库的创建和部署效率。通过使用数据库模板,开发人员可以避免手动创建数据库对象和插入初始数据的繁琐过程。只需使用模板,即可快速创建一个具有预定义结构和数据的数据库。
TPL数据库模板的优势在于其灵活性和可定制性。开发人员可以根据项目需求自定义数据库模板,包括定义表结构、字段类型、约束条件等。模板还可以包含常见的数据库最佳实践,如性能优化、数据安全等。
在实际应用中,TPL数据库模板可以广泛应用于各种场景。例如,开发人员可以使用TPL模板来创建一个新的电子商务网站的数据库,其中包括商品、订单、用户等表结构和相关数据。另外,企业内部的常见业务模块,如人力资源、客户关系管理等,也可以通过TPL模板来创建数据库。
总之,TPL数据库模板是一种用于快速创建数据库的工具,可以提高开发效率和数据库的一致性。通过使用TPL模板,开发人员可以快速创建和部署数据库,从而更专注于业务逻辑的开发。
1年前 -
TPL是一个开源的数据库管理系统,全称为Transparent Persistent Library。它是一个轻量级的嵌入式数据库,适用于嵌入式系统和移动设备等资源受限的环境。下面将详细介绍TPL数据库的五个特点。
-
轻量级和高性能:TPL数据库被设计成轻量级的数据库管理系统,它具有很小的存储和内存占用。这使得它非常适合在资源受限的环境中使用。尽管它是轻量级的,但TPL仍然具有很高的性能。它使用了一些优化技术,如数据缓存和索引等,以提高数据的读写速度。
-
嵌入式数据库:TPL数据库是一个嵌入式数据库,它可以直接集成到应用程序中,而不需要独立的数据库服务器。这样一来,开发人员可以更方便地使用数据库,而无需担心网络连接和服务器配置等问题。嵌入式数据库还可以减少系统资源的占用,并提高应用程序的响应速度。
-
支持多种数据类型:TPL数据库支持多种数据类型,包括整数、浮点数、字符串、日期、时间和布尔值等。开发人员可以根据应用程序的需求选择合适的数据类型来存储和处理数据。此外,TPL还支持复杂数据结构,如数组和哈希表等,以便更灵活地组织和管理数据。
-
事务支持:TPL数据库支持事务处理,这意味着开发人员可以将一系列数据库操作作为一个原子操作来处理。在事务中,如果其中一个操作失败,整个事务将被回滚,以保持数据库的一致性。这对于需要确保数据完整性和一致性的应用程序非常重要。
-
跨平台支持:TPL数据库是跨平台的,可以在不同的操作系统上运行,包括Windows、Linux和macOS等。这使得开发人员可以在不同的环境中使用TPL数据库,而无需修改代码。此外,TPL还提供了多种编程接口,如C、C++和Python等,以方便开发人员使用不同的编程语言访问数据库。
1年前 -
-
TPL并不是一个具体的数据库,而是一个缩写,代表“Template”。在计算机科学中,模板(Template)通常指的是一种用于生成特定格式输出的文件或数据结构。模板可以包含预定义的文本和占位符,用于插入动态生成的内容。
模板在数据库中常用于生成动态的网页、报表或其他格式化的输出。数据库存储和管理数据,而模板则用于将数据以特定的格式呈现给用户。通过使用模板,可以实现数据和显示的分离,提高代码的可维护性和灵活性。
下面将介绍一种常见的使用模板的数据库操作流程,以MySQL为例:
-
创建数据库表结构:首先需要设计数据库表结构,包括表的字段和类型。可以使用SQL语句在MySQL数据库中创建表。
-
插入数据:通过SQL语句向数据库中插入数据,数据可以来自用户输入、文件导入等。
-
查询数据:通过SQL语句从数据库中查询数据。查询结果可以是一条记录或多条记录,可以根据需要使用条件、排序等进行筛选。
-
处理数据:对查询结果进行处理,将需要的数据提取出来。可以使用编程语言(如PHP、Python等)进行数据处理和逻辑操作。
-
使用模板:将处理后的数据传递给模板,使用模板引擎进行渲染。模板引擎可以根据模板文件中的占位符,将数据动态插入到模板中。
-
生成输出:模板引擎将渲染后的模板生成最终的输出结果,可以是HTML网页、PDF报表等。输出结果可以保存到文件或直接返回给用户。
-
更新数据:如果需要更新数据库中的数据,可以通过SQL语句执行更新操作。更新可以是插入新数据、修改已有数据或删除数据。
总结:
TPL是模板的缩写,用于生成特定格式输出的文件或数据结构。在数据库中,模板常用于将数据以特定的格式呈现给用户。数据库操作流程包括创建表结构、插入数据、查询数据、处理数据、使用模板、生成输出和更新数据。模板引擎可以帮助实现数据和显示的分离,提高代码的可维护性和灵活性。1年前 -